		    		Draw"bridge` (?), n. A bridge of
which either the whole or a part is made to be raised up, let down,
or drawn or turned aside, to admit or hinder communication at
pleasure, as before the gate of a town or castle, or over a navigable
river or canal. 
&fist; The movable portion, or draw, is called, specifically, a
bascule, balance, or lifting bridge, a
turning, swivel, or swing bridge, or a
rolling bridge, according as it turns on a hinge vertically,
or on a pivot horizontally, or is pushed on rollers. 
  
		    		 - Webster's Unabridged Dictionary (1913)
